Blundell Harling Ltd is a privately owned, medium sized manufacturing company that has been trading in the UK since 1948. The company employs multi-skilled personnel. Specialising in manufacturing small to medium sized batches it serves multiple ‘niche’ markets. Blundell Harling Ltd operates from a single site of 42,000 square feet in Weymouth, Dorset which was purpose built in 1986.
Since 1948 Blundell Harling Ltd has manufactured and distributed an extensive range of drawing equipment, scale rules, templates and technical drawing equipment for use by technical students in further education, architects, engineers, specialist designers, draughts people, and graphic artists. The company also designs circular calculators branded ‘BH Datadiscs’, slidecharts and overprinted scale rules for promotional and advertising use.

The ruler is raised by the midbump to prevent the residual ink or lead from leaving a secondary mark on the page. It is typically used with either a mechanical or clutch pencil, the lead is extended longer then it would be from regular drawing or construction. The pencil is held straight so it is perpendicular to the paper and creates a right angle with the ruler. (Note the lead should be touching the ruler, not the pencil itself.)
